This release includes several bug fixes and enhancements. I found a page that described how to make what im looking for however, following that advice along with how i think im supposed to make an executable jar war isnt working. In this article, we will be looking at the jetty library. It builds on the command line of course googling the exception says that it is a problem with classloader. It supports jetty 69 has an own jetty 8 included and works well in conjunction with the m2e maven integration. It is recommended that all users upgrade as soon as they are able. The jetty image inherits from the openjdk image and supports all of the configuration options described in the java runtime. Jettylauncher is an eclipse plugin for running debugging java web applications with jetty winstone servlet container winstone is a java servlet container spec v2. September 2014 newest version yes organization not specified url not specified license not specified dependencies amount. This is intended to be the first post in a series on building straightforward webapps with springmvc and embedded jetty. The latest release of eclipse jetty is below, earlier minor release versions are available in maven central. I am using maven 2 for dependency and build management. All releases are always available there first and this download page may lag a bit update wise as post release resources are put into place.
It is strongly recommended to use the latest release version of apache maven to take advantage of newest features and bug fixes. Download jar files for jetty server with dependencies documentation source code. Ch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. The axis build has been migrated from ant to maven.
To get started well add maven dependencies to jetty server and jetty servlet libraries. The work around in the mean time is to use maven 2. When developing the application, when making code changes, i want the jetty server to restart and reload the modified code files automatically. Come to think of it, maybe i can run embedder in an isolated special classloader so that i can hide maven outside hudson. Downloading jetty source and javadoc jars with maven and linking. Eliminate the costs of dealing with guarantors or security deposit accounts. This article will be introducing the reader to how to install jetty into windows server 2008 r2 as a windows service. Rerun maven using the x switch to enable full debug log idas nov 20 15 at 17. You can use archetypes to quickly setup maven projects, but for this tutorial, we will set up the structure manually. Apache maven is a build automation tool for java, which builds war files for deployment.
Jetty can be easily embedded in devices, tools, frameworks, application servers, and clusters. A full list of changes for this release is listed at the end of this email. Aug 25, 2012 setting up embedded jetty 8 and spring mvc with maven. The current recommended version for use is jetty 9 which can be obtained on the jetty downloads page. When developing web apps in maven, its a common practice to store the javascritp sources under srcmainjs. For this you can replace the dependency on jetty server with a dependency on the jetty servlet artifact. Jetty modern financial services for properties and residents. Im running into problems using jetty maven plugin with java 11.
May 11, 2020 the eclipse jetty 9 runtime uses openjdk 8 and jetty 9 with support for java servlet 3. In the first run, eclipse will download jetty maven plugin, so you have to wait until the download is completed copy the link below to run on your browser. All releases are always available there first and this download page may lag a bit update wise as post. The eclipse jetty plugin enables runningdebugging of java web applications with jetty in the eclipse ide. Adding the app engine maven and eclipse jetty maven plugins. Build plugins will be executed during the build and they should be. Remove paperwork pileups and outdated barriers to entry. Jettytutorialjetty and maven helloworld eclipsepedia. This post describes configuring your jetty and spring mvc with xmlbased configuration.
Jsf primefaces hello world example using jetty and maven. If youre using the plugin with jetty 6, see the jetty 6 maven plugin guide at codehaus. Im trying to make an executable war file java jar mywarfile. Jetty provides a web server that can run as an embedded container and integrates easily with the javax. Support for jetty 6, 7, 8 and 9 included jetty8 m2eclipse support jsp support jndi support. Add the bin directory of the created directory apache maven 3. Eclipse jetty integration eclipse jetty integration. You can add it to any webapp project that is structured according to the maven defaults.
It provides a collection of mostly visual components widgets that can be used by jsf programmers to build the ui for a web application. The canonical repository for eclipse jetty is maven central. By default the jetty plugin scans targetclasses for any changes in your java sources and srcmainwebapp for changes to your web sources. This implies that the source distribution has a completely different structure. Annotation support for deploying servlets in jetty. The canonical repository for jetty is maven central. First, download maven and follow the installation instructions. There are some maven plugins that are full servlet containers. The short summary is that maven inside hudson used in the embedder and maven outside hudson thats running jetty interferes. Apache maven war plugin rapid testing using the jetty plugin. To get started, i decided to write a simple test application. List of common commands for working with the maven openmrs branch. You can check out the complete source of this simple project from github. Download jettyserver jar files with all dependencies.
Jetty gives you access to industryleading insurance products, built to streamline the leasing process and improve conversion. If you still want to use an old version you can find more information in the maven releases history and can download files from the archives for versions 3. Maven available plugins apache maven apache software. This jetty wiki provides information about getting started with jetty, basic configuration, specific features, optimization, security, javaee, monitoring, faqs, help with troubleshooting, and more. Java project tutorial make login and register form step by step using netbeans and mysql database duration. This release contains a number of bug fixes and, as always, we recommend users upgrade to. Maven uses convention over configuration, so it is best to use the project structure as maven recommends. Also available are the latest maintenance releases of jetty 8 and jetty 7. Search and download functionalities are using the official maven repository. As many know that when run java app on a windows server, it is almost impossible to run it in the background as easy as running the same app on unix server.
Run maven java web application in jetty maven plugin. The information on this page refers to the plugin versions for jetty 7 and above. Maven branch except for the jetty command, all commands are expected to be run from. Download jettymavenplugin jar files with all dependencies. This is useful, for example, when using the jetty maven plugin that allows you to. Maven is at its heart a plugin execution framework. Each jetty module has an equivalent jar containing the sources for that module. It should print out your installed version of maven, for example. Jun 15, 2011 there are some maven plugins that are full servlet containers. A full list of changes for this release are listed at the end of this email. Alternatively use your preferred archive extraction tool. An eclipse plugin for runningdebugging java web applications with jetty successor of jettylauncher features. Jsf primefaces hello world example using jetty and maven 5 minute read primefaces is an open source component library for javaserver faces jsf. I am also using the jetty maven plugin to run the web application locally using mvn pl webapp jetty.
Maven maven in 5 minutes apache maven apache software. Jetty can be used in all kinds of projects or products and it can be implemented into devices, tools, frameworks, app servers and all kinds of clusters. This release available on the eclipse jetty project download page or from the maven central repository. Youll see how intellij idea executes the install build phase and all the. Download jar files for jetty with dependencies documentation source code all downloads are free. When i try to build it, i get an exception from maven 2. Setting up embedded jetty 8 and spring mvc with maven. This plugin can be used as an alternative to the axis ant tasks. Using maven for jetty implementations is a popular choice, but users encouraged to. It will compile, run tests, build all artifacts and install them to your local repo. Build plugins will be executed during the build and they should be configured in the element from the pom. But keep getting this error, cannot understand why please give me a hand. Jetty offers stunning server capabilities and comes with many useful features.
420 1449 641 450 960 1557 624 196 1517 1198 680 638 1461 250 1531 732 1025 474 885 444 684 363 214 1007 1323 210 307 981 185 614 140 473 1119 1024 378 906 144